Simplifying Bulk Trade for Electronics Businesses

0
7

Bulk trade is the backbone of the electronics industry. From retailers and distributors to service centers and corporate buyers, large-volume purchasing keeps supply chains moving and businesses profitable. However, bulk trade in electronics is often complex, involving multiple suppliers, fluctuating prices, logistics challenges, and quality concerns. Simplifying this process has become essential for electronic businesses looking to operate efficiently and scale sustainably.

Modern trade practices, supported by organized systems and digital tools, are transforming how bulk electronics sourcing is managed, making it more predictable and less resource-intensive.

The Complexity of Bulk Electronics Trade

Electronics products come with unique challenges. Rapid technological changes, frequent product updates, and short life cycles make sourcing more demanding than in many other industries. Bulk buyers must ensure compatibility, quality standards, and consistent availability, all while managing costs.

Traditional bulk trade methods often rely on fragmented supplier networks and manual coordination. This leads to delays, pricing inconsistencies, and higher operational risks, especially for businesses handling large volumes.

Centralized Sourcing for Better Control

One of the most effective ways to simplify bulk trade is centralized sourcing. Instead of managing multiple supplier relationships independently, electronics businesses can consolidate procurement through organized channels.

Centralization improves visibility across suppliers, products, and pricing. Buyers can compare options more easily, standardize procurement processes, and reduce the time spent coordinating orders. This structure brings control and clarity to bulk purchasing decisions.

Transparent Pricing and Cost Management

Price volatility is a common concern in electronics trade. Component shortages, demand spikes, and currency fluctuations can all impact pricing. Simplified bulk trade systems introduce transparency by making pricing structures clear and comparable.

When businesses have access to transparent pricing, they can negotiate more effectively and plan budgets with greater accuracy. For example, sourcing wholesale computer accessories through structured channels allows buyers to evaluate cost differences across suppliers and avoid overpaying due to limited information.

Streamlined Ordering and Logistics

Bulk orders involve complex logistics, including packaging, transportation, and delivery scheduling. Simplifying trade requires streamlined order management systems that handle these complexities efficiently.

Digital order tracking, consolidated shipments, and standardized documentation reduce errors and delays. Electronics businesses benefit from faster turnaround times and improved coordination between procurement, warehousing, and sales teams.

Ensuring Product Quality and Consistency

Quality assurance is critical in electronics bulk trade. Defective or incompatible products can lead to returns, reputational damage, and financial loss. Simplified trade models emphasize supplier verification, standardized specifications, and clear return policies.

By working with reliable suppliers and organized procurement systems, businesses can maintain consistent quality across large orders. This consistency builds trust with downstream partners and end customers alike.

Reducing Operational Overhead

Managing bulk trade manually consumes significant time and resources. Negotiations, follow-ups, paperwork, and inventory reconciliation add to operational overhead. Simplified trade processes reduce these burdens through automation and standardized workflows.

Lower operational costs directly improve profitability. Businesses can redirect saved resources toward growth initiatives such as expanding product lines, improving customer service, or entering new markets.

Scalability for Growing Electronics Businesses

As electronics businesses grow, their bulk trade requirements become more complex. Order volumes increase, supplier coordination intensifies, and inventory management becomes more challenging. Simplified bulk trade systems are designed to scale alongside business growth.

Scalable procurement allows businesses to handle higher volumes without proportionally increasing complexity. This flexibility supports long-term expansion and helps businesses respond quickly to market opportunities.

Data-Driven Decision Making

Simplified bulk trade is increasingly supported by data insights. Purchase histories, demand trends, and supplier performance metrics help businesses make informed decisions.

With access to reliable data, electronic businesses can forecast demand more accurately, optimize inventory levels, and identify cost-saving opportunities. Data-driven sourcing reduces uncertainty and strengthens strategic planning.

Strengthening Supplier Relationships

Simplification does not mean sacrificing relationships. In fact, organized bulk trade often leads to stronger supplier partnerships. Clear expectations, standardized processes, and consistent order volumes create mutual trust.

Strong relationships resulted in better pricing, priority fulfillment, and improved collaboration on new products or market expansion. These benefits further simplify trade over time.

Conclusion

Simplifying bulk trade is essential for electronic businesses navigating a fast-paced and competitive market. Through centralized sourcing, transparent pricing, streamlined logistics, and data-driven insights, businesses can reduce complexity and improve operational efficiency. A simplified approach to bulk trade not only lowers costs and risks but also creates a strong foundation for sustainable growth in the evolving electronics industry.
